Preguntas Frecuentes
How big does Flameback angelfish get?
Flameback angelfish can grow up to 7.5 cm long.
Where is Flameback angelfish found?
Coral reefs
What family does Flameback angelfish belong to?
Flameback angelfish (Centropyge aurantonotus) belongs to the family Pomacanthidae (Angelfishes) in the order Perciformes (Perch-like fishes).
